West Brom defender Nathan Ferguson has recently been linked with a move to Premier League side Crystal Palace according to a report from The Athletic

The Baggies youngster has caught the eye with a number of impressive performances to date, and it seems as though his strong showings haven't gone unnoticed.

Ferguson has made 21 appearances for Slaven Bilic's side this term in all competitions, and has been on hand to score once and provide one assist this season. 

West Brom are currently sat second in the Championship table, and will be hoping they can hold their nerve in the race for promotion into the top-flight with nine games remaining.

However, that promotion bid has come to an abrupt halt recently, with the EFL announcing that fixtures won't get back underway until it is deemed safe enough to do so.

Ferguson took to Instagram during the break from action to post a picture of him and his West Brom team-mates, which is likely to go down well with the Baggies supporters, who will be keen to see the youngster remain with the club for the foreseeable future.
